Alfred Comte
Alfred Comte (1895–1965) was a Swiss photographer, aircraft pilot and entrepreneur.

Overview
Born at Delémont in 1895, died at Zurich in 1965.
In detail
Works named in the authority record are Comte AC-1, Comte AC-4, Comte AC-3, Comte AC-8, Comte AC-11-V and Comte AC-12 Moskito.
